About this property

Lovely country cottage in its own peaceful orchard with stunning views

La Boulangerie has an open plan living room/kitchen and 1 upstairs bedroom with 2 single beds and an ensuite shower room.

Situated on a quiet country lane with its own entrance, La Boulangerie is a perfect base for a holiday in Normandy. This 'petit' gite, is a charming converted farm bakery sitting in its own orchard of apple, pear, cherry and plum trees. The ground floor has an open-plan kitchen/living area, with staircase to the first floor. The cottage is heated by electric radiators. Upstairs the bedroom has 2 single beds, a chest of drawers, clothes rail and an ensuite shower room. There is free WiFi. The 45" Ultra 4k HD Smart TV has English Freesat Channels and Freesat French channels. You can access Netflix and other apps. using your own account. There is a DVD player, with a wide selection of DVDs. The kitchen is fully equipped - all you need for a holiday home. At the front there is a patio with a masonry barbecue, a bench, table and chairs. Sun loungers, a parasol, picnic chairs and table, 2 mountain bikes, Boules, and an outdoor Swingball Game are also provided, along with a fire bowl for those cooler evenings. To the side and rear there are lovely open views of the countryside. There is no light pollution and the stars are amazing. There is ample parking space on the drive. The cottage boasts the original stone and clay oven (attached to the outside) along with many other attractive features. Duvets, pillows, bed linen, dishcloths, towels and tea towels are provided, along with cleaning products and toilet rolls.

LOCAL ATTRACTIONS

BRÉCEY - 5 mins drive, is a pleasant market town with small shops, a newsagents, cafes, bar tabacs, lovely bakeries, 2 supermarkets, restaurants, banks, a vet surgery, hairdressers, doctors and dentists, a garage and petrol stations. Friday is market day for buying local produce, fish, and cheeses.

En route to Brécey from the cottage (5 mins drive) there is a lovely lake, perfect for an evening stroll. There are 2 municipal heated open air swimming pools by the campsite at the lakeside, open June, July and August. Opposite the lake there is an equestrian centre where events are held, and pony trekking is available. There is also a Boules court and tennis courts. Within 10 minutes drive there are fishing lakes en route to Avranches. The beautiful Normandy coastline is only a 30 minute drive away.

AROUND AND ABOUT

AVRANCHES - 20 mins drive, the nearest large town, has many shops, restaurants, museums, and the famous Jardin de Plantes, with impressive views out to Mont St Michel. Summer concerts are held in the gardens.

PARC de la BAIE, AVRANCHES - is a large shopping centre on the outskirts of the town, with a Carrefour Hypermarket and Jardiland, a lovely garden centre with a huge gift shop.

VILLEDIEU LES POELES - 20 mins drive. A pretty town which has a working bell foundry you can visit, along with copper workshops and copper goods to see and buy.

CHAMPREUSE ZOO - just outside Villedieu Les Poeles has amazing themed gardens set out in the style of several continents.

PARC ANGE MICHEL - 30 minutes drive. Large theme park with over 30 rides.

ST HILAIRE DU HARCOUET - 20 mins drive. Has the largest and most popular market in the area. There is also a picturesque church, park and lake.

BELLEFONTAINE, The Enchanted Village - 20 mins drive. Has over 30 leisure activities, including zip wires, a canopy walk, and a miniature village.

MORTAIN - 35 mins drive. Has superb walks by two waterfalls, pony-trekking, go-karting, the famous Abbaye Blanche (White Abbey) and a popular walking/cycling route along a disused railway track (the Voie Verte).

MONT ST MICHEL - 40 mins drive. A UNESCO World Heritage Site, with many historic, medieval, buildings, Abbey and restaurants. Take a guided walk across the bay.

GRANVILLE - 40 mins drive. Historic city with lovely views from the ramparts. Ferries run to the magical Isles of Chausey.

BEACHES are 30-40 mins drive. lovely sandy beaches at Carolles and Jullouville. The Route de Sentier is a promenade by the beach which goes through all the main resorts from Carolles to Granville.

CANCALE - 1 hours drive. Popular with locals and tourists alike, famed for its mussel beds, oyster stalls and seafood restaurants.

BAYEAUX - 1 hours drive. Has the famous tapestry.

D DAY LANDING BEACHES - are a short drive from Bayeaux.

DINAN - 1 hours drive. Lovely, pedestrianised, medieval town with a picturesque riverside.
